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84 2543148 3317 3223 59651064
45401703 1327133057
45401703 1327133057
32448359 206832859 590314 05
All about undefined
Interested in learning more?
45401703 1327133057
32448359 206832859 590314 05
See more
336 2005588118
5504 007307 162003
See more
7603482625 25428263
07 903397 40050 24369671889 76652193
See more